Tha Kha Floating Market

Open Days: Saturday – Sunday and public holidays
Opening Hours: 06:00 – 14:00
 
Tha Kha Floating Market is located in Tha Kha Subdistrict, Amphawa District, Samut Songkhram Province. It is one of the few floating markets in Thailand that still preserves the traditional way of life of local orchard communities. Vendors continue to use small paddle boats to bring fresh produce from their gardens for sale and exchange, reflecting a lifestyle that has been passed down for generations.
 
Unlike large and highly commercialized floating markets, Tha Kha remains a genuine local marketplace. Most villagers are farmers who grow a variety of crops, especially coconut, fruits, and vegetables. Products commonly found here include chili, shallots, garlic, guava, coconut, rose apples, pomelo, and coconut sugar, which is a signature product of Samut Songkhram.
 
What makes this market unique is its calm and authentic atmosphere. There are fewer tourists, allowing visitors to walk around comfortably, interact with local vendors, and observe traditional trading practices. In some cases, barter trading still takes place among locals, offering a rare glimpse into a fading cultural tradition.
 
The surrounding environment features small canals, wooden houses, and lush coconut plantations, creating a peaceful rural setting. Visitors can also enjoy traditional Thai desserts and local dishes made from fresh ingredients sourced directly from nearby farms.
 
Getting There is convenient. Visitors can drive along Highway No. 325 (Samut Songkhram – Bang Phae route) to kilometer 32, then turn right and continue for about 5 kilometers. Public transportation is also available from Samut Songkhram town, with buses running from approximately 07:00 to 18:00, departing every 20 minutes on the Tha Kha – Wat Thep Prasit route.
 
The best time to visit is early in the morning when the market is most active and the weather is cooler. It is an ideal destination for travelers seeking an authentic cultural experience and a peaceful environment away from crowded tourist spots.
